At this point in the release cycle, we’re still seeing a steady flow of new Nike Zoom Kobe Vs, but wouldn’t you like to see the next upcoming Kobe Bryant signature?! This mysterious sample appears to quite possibly be an early version of the Zoom Kobe VI. Whether this sample proves to be the final version or if it winds up looking totally different is yet to be seen, but at least you can say you got an early glimpse. Pictured above is another lowtop look, this particular pair going with a super-simple white-on-black colorway. The shots are somewhat shadowy, but you can still make out Flywire on the side panels, plus an interestingly sculpted midsole. There’s also a new ‘KB’ insignia on the heel, so check out more images after the jump and stick with Sneaker News for updates on all of Kobe’s Nikes. via HoopChina
